В течение прошлой недели или около того, стандартное диалоговое окно «Завершение работы» появляется случайным образом без видимой причины.
Я обновил с 12.04 до 12.10, и это все еще продолжается. Это невероятно раздражает.
Это может появиться, когда я просто набираю текстовый документ, спустя часы после загрузки компьютера, или это может произойти через три секунды после того, как я вошел в систему и не имел возможность взаимодействия с рабочим столом.
Если я нажму «Отмена», диалоговое окно может снова появиться через несколько секунд или несколько часов. Иногда ноутбук просто выключается через несколько секунд после нажатия «Отмена».
Когда появляется это диалоговое окно, я не вижу ничего странного в /var/log/*log
и не вижу запущенных подозрительных процессов.
Мне удалось запечатлеть это, отслеживая сессионную шину dbus, когда появляется диалоговое окно:
method call sender=:1.6 -> dest=org.gnome.SessionManager serial=285 path=/org/gnome/SessionManager; interface=org.gnome.SessionManager; member=Shutdown
method return sender=:1.0 -> dest=:1.6 reply_serial=285
Но это не дает мне понятия о , который запрашивает отключение .
Кнопка физического питания (на этом Thinkpad T420s) не связана с приглашением выключения, и нажатие на нее ничего не делает.
Я также видел случайное отключение, когда я загружаю ноутбук, а затем убиваю lightdm
, чтобы не работал X-сервер. В какой-то момент компьютер может время от времени говорить, что отключается из-за отключения. Тогда это так.
Есть какие-нибудь идеи, что это может быть или как я могу отлаживать дальше?
Обновление:
Это также происходит с живым CD Ubuntu 10.04 и USB-накопитель 12.04 в режиме реального времени.
Однако я выгрузил свой SSD и вставил оригинальный HDD, и я смог без проблем установить и запустить Windows 7 некоторое время.
Итак, поскольку эта проблема появилась недавно и возникает в нескольких версиях ОС, я предполагаю, что это потенциально аппаратная проблема. Но, учитывая, что я не вижу, что (я не видел каких-либо нажатий на фантомные клавиши в showkey
) неправильно, и поскольку Windows работает, у меня нет подходящего повода для того, чтобы позвонить по гарантии Thinkpad ... [ 1120]
Я считаю, что это вызвано аппаратной ошибкой.
Используя инструмент acpi_listen
, я смог увидеть, что событие button/power PWRF
генерировалось при появлении диалогового окна выключения. Это то, что произойдет, если вы удерживаете кнопку физического питания в течение нескольких секунд.
Ноутбук полностью отключается время от времени, что эквивалентно удержанию кнопки питания в течение пяти секунд или около того.
Мне удалось воспроизвести это в других версиях Ubuntu, но в конечном итоге и под Windows 7.
Так что я предполагаю, что в контроллере клавиатуры есть что-то вроде сбоя, из-за которого отправляются события фантомного включения.
В настоящее время я использую USB-клавиатуру, и в течение пары часов не происходило никаких событий выключения. Похоже, это срабатывает при использовании встроенной клавиатуры для ввода.
Тайна раскрыта. Надеюсь, Lenovo увидит это так же ...